1. Injury Extent

Injury extent is a major issue influencing bumper restore prices. The severity of the impression instantly correlates with the mandatory restore procedures and consequently, the general expense. Understanding the assorted classes of injury helps anticipate potential prices and facilitates knowledgeable decision-making.

  • Scratches and Scuffs

    Superficial harm like gentle scratches or scuffs usually requires minimal intervention. Restore may contain sanding, buffing, and touch-up paint, leading to comparatively decrease prices. Examples embrace minor car parking zone scrapes or gentle contact with roadside particles. These repairs usually vary from $50 to $300 relying on the automobile’s end and the store’s labor charges.

  • Dents and Dings

    Deeper impacts inflicting dents or dings necessitate extra in depth repairs. Strategies like paintless dent restore (PDR) is perhaps appropriate for some dents, whereas others require filling, sanding, and repainting. Prices usually vary from $200 to $800, influenced by the dimensions and placement of the dent.

  • Cracks and Tears

    Cracks and tears within the bumper cowl signify extra substantial harm, usually ensuing from higher-impact collisions. Relying on the severity and placement of the harm, restore may contain patching, plastic welding, or full bumper alternative. Prices can vary from $500 to $1,500 or extra.

  • Underlying Structural Injury

    In extreme collisions, harm can lengthen past the bumper cowl to underlying elements just like the bumper reinforcement bar, absorber, or sensors. Repairing or changing these elements considerably will increase the general value. Estimates for such repairs usually exceed $1,500 and might attain a number of thousand {dollars} relying on the automobile and extent of the harm.

Precisely assessing the harm extent is essential for acquiring sensible restore estimates. Whereas minor harm is perhaps addressed with comparatively cheap beauty repairs, important structural harm necessitates extra extensiveand costlyinterventions. Consulting with respected restore outlets and acquiring a number of estimates permits automobile homeowners to make knowledgeable selections aligned with their funds and the automobile’s particular wants.

2. Bumper Materials

Bumper materials considerably influences restore prices. Completely different supplies possess various properties impacting repairability, half availability, and related labor. Understanding these distinctions is important for anticipating potential bills.

Plastic Bumpers (Thermoplastics): Most fashionable automobiles make the most of thermoplastic bumpers because of their cost-effectiveness, light-weight nature, and suppleness. Minor harm like scratches and dents can usually be repaired utilizing warmth weapons, fillers, and specialised adhesives. Nevertheless, extra extreme harm may necessitate alternative. Plastic bumpers provide a comparatively economical restore choice in comparison with different supplies.

Fiberglass Bumpers (Thermosetting Plastics): Fiberglass bumpers, widespread in older automobiles or customized purposes, current distinctive restore challenges. Their inflexible construction makes them much less amenable to minor dent restore. Cracks and tears usually require specialised resin and fiberglass matting, growing labor and materials prices. Repairs might be extra complicated and costly than these for thermoplastic bumpers.

Metallic Bumpers (Metal, Aluminum, Chrome): Whereas much less prevalent in up to date automobiles, metallic bumpers nonetheless seem in some vehicles and basic automobiles. Metal bumpers, recognized for sturdiness, can usually be repaired utilizing conventional bodywork methods like hammering, welding, and filling. Aluminum and chrome bumpers, although light-weight and aesthetically interesting, current particular challenges. Aluminum requires specialised welding methods, whereas chrome plating necessitates re-chroming for a seamless end. Metallic bumper repairs might be labor-intensive and, consequently, costlier.

Carbon Fiber Bumpers: Discovered totally on high-performance or luxurious automobiles, carbon fiber bumpers signify the premium finish of the fabric spectrum. Their light-weight and robust properties come at a big value. Repairing carbon fiber requires specialised experience and supplies, making it the costliest bumper materials to restore or exchange. Even minor harm can necessitate in depth repairs, reflecting the intricate nature of carbon fiber building.

Selecting a restore store skilled with the precise bumper materials is essential. Making an attempt to restore a carbon fiber bumper with methods appropriate for plastic can result in additional harm and elevated prices. Recognizing the inherent value implications of every materials empowers knowledgeable decision-making and helps set up sensible restore expectations.

6. Paint Prices

Paint prices signify a significant factor inside total bumper restore bills. A number of components affect these prices, instantly impacting the ultimate restore invoice. Understanding these components allows knowledgeable decision-making and facilitates sensible funds expectations. The kind of paint required, particularly whether or not the automobile necessitates a typical, metallic, or pearlescent end, instantly correlates with materials bills. Metallic and pearlescent paints, containing mica or specialised pigments, command greater costs because of their complicated composition and software processes. Matching these specialised finishes requires exact color-matching methods and specialised tools, additional influencing prices.

The extent of the restore space additionally considerably impacts paint prices. Minor scratches or scuffs requiring localized touch-ups incur decrease paint bills in comparison with bigger areas needing full panel repainting. For instance, repairing a small scratch may contain minimal paint utilization and localized mixing, whereas addressing a big dent or crack necessitates extra in depth paint software and mixing throughout a wider space. This distinction in protection instantly interprets to various paint prices. Moreover, the variety of paint coats required influences materials utilization and labor time. Attaining a flawless end usually necessitates a number of base coats, shade coats, and clear coats, every contributing to the general paint expense. The precise software approach, whether or not using conventional spray weapons or extra superior HVLP (high-volume, low-pressure) programs, may impression paint utilization and labor time, subsequently influencing prices.

7. Alternative Elements

Alternative elements represent a considerable issue influencing bumper restore prices. The need for half alternative versus restore considerably impacts the general expense. A number of components decide this want, together with the extent of injury, half availability, and automobile mannequin specifics. Extreme harm, similar to deep cracks, tears, or structural deformation, usually necessitates full bumper alternative. Repairing such harm is perhaps structurally unsound or aesthetically compromised. For example, a severely cracked bumper cowl usually requires alternative, whereas a minor dent is perhaps repairable utilizing fillers and paint. Equally, harm to built-in elements like parking sensors or lighting assemblies usually mandates changing the complete bumper meeting because of their built-in design.

Half availability performs an important function in value dedication. Frequent automobile fashions profit from available aftermarket or OEM elements, providing cost-effective choices. Conversely, older or much less widespread fashions may require sourcing elements from salvage yards or specialty suppliers, probably growing prices and restore timelines. A available aftermarket bumper cowl for a well-liked sedan may cost considerably lower than a uncommon, discontinued bumper for a basic automotive. Car mannequin specifics additionally affect alternative half prices. Luxurious or high-performance automobiles usually make the most of premium supplies and complicated designs, leading to greater half costs in comparison with customary fashions. A carbon fiber bumper cowl for a sports activities automotive will inherently value greater than a typical plastic bumper for an financial system automotive. Moreover, selecting between OEM and aftermarket elements influences value. OEM elements, manufactured by the unique automobile producer, usually value greater than aftermarket alternate options produced by third-party suppliers. Whereas OEM elements assure high quality and match, aftermarket choices provide cost-effective alternate options for budget-conscious repairs.
